Statistics

  • Internet growth exponential - doubles every 3 to 6 months
  • Approximately 11 million hosts today (computers hosting Internet sites)
  • Internet users in the world in the hundreds of millions

Conclusion

The Internet holds vast opportunity for young people, whether it be to assist in their learning processes or give them access to the world's largest information source. It allows communication between people and isolated communities. The Internet will continue to grow into our lives and progress.
